* Luis Suarez was named in Uruguay’s final squad of 23 players for Copa America despite continuing to recover from a knee injury. Suarez missed Barcelona’s last matches of the season, including the Copa del Rey final loss to Valencia after having an operation.

* With Neymar on the sidelines, Dani Alves will captain Brazil at the Copa America. He is back at full fitness, while Alisson pips Manchester City’s Ederson for the goalkeeper’s jersey after both saw action for the national team this year.

* Atletico Madrid have known since March that star man Antoine Griezmann was going to move to Barcelona, according to club CEO Gil Marin. The 28-year-old Frenchman has confirmed to the club his desire to leave, but has also been linked with a possible move to the Premiershi­p in England. * USA defender Tyler Adams is out of the Concacaf Gold Cup because of chronic groin issues. The RB Leipzig youngster is replaced by FC Dallas right-back Reggie Cannon.

* Romelu Lukaku has revealed he has made a decision on his Manchester United future as Inter Milan continue to keep tabs on his status there. The striker had a tough season at club level in which he lost his place in the first team at Old Trafford. Lukaku struggled to impress under Jose Mourinho’s leadership at the start of last season and continued to underwhelm when Ole Gunnar Solskjaer replaced the sacked manager in December.
